GM Magnus Carlsen is the winner of Norway Chess 2025! GM Fabiano Caruana finished in 2nd place, while the reigning World Champion, GM Gukesh Dommaraju, took 3rd place. GM Anna Muzychuk secured 1st place in the Women's Tournament, with GM Lei Tingjie coming in 2nd and GM Koneru Humpy in 3rd place.

GM Aravindh Chithambaram won the 6th Stepan Avagyan Memorial ahead of GM Rameshbabu Praggnanandhaa, repeating his success at the 2025 Prague International Chess Festival, and climbed to 9th in the live ratings!
